Output 85e63fd5f826a10f83832f226275c2497523b6bdb37a9ea4b2fcdc1e13ffadeb:1

value
573011729
script pubkey
OP_0 OP_PUSHBYTES_20 0cf643b2cd6d0910b8114977d28206c5a62b19c0
address
tb1qpnmy8vkdd5y3pwq3f9ma9qsxcknzkxwqrt4uu2
transaction
85e63fd5f826a10f83832f226275c2497523b6bdb37a9ea4b2fcdc1e13ffadeb
confirmations
104983
spent
true